Some nuggets of wisdom: Silicon Valley Comes To Oxford - 2009

This is a repost, borrowed in full from http://letsgoexploring.blogspot.com/2009/11/silicon-valley-comes-to-oxford-2009.html. But, reading it i thought that this has to be a part of the blog. My apologies if i'm flouting any copyright rules.

Some nuggets of wisdom:

"If you're not embarrassed by your first product, you've launched too late." -- Reid Hoffman

"You pitch an entrepreneur with success.. not with work-life balance." -- Reid Hoffman

"Don't fall in love with your product. Stay close to the market." -- Kim Polese

"The future will be there." -- Reid Hoffman

"There is an alchemy that takes place when you decide to share something publicly rather than privately - it becomes valuable" -- Biz Stone

"Deciding to take on a global issue doesn't mean you need to be arrogant enough to think you're going to solve them." -- Biz Stone

"Don't be afraid to start over again. Don't forget to trust your gut. Contradictory? Maybe. But you need both." -- Kim Polese

"Most people use only 7 sites. If you want to insert a new one into their lives, ask yourself.. which one are you replacing?" -- Reid Hoffman

"Innovation is spelled R-I-S-K." -- Reid Hoffman

"Which one of the 7 deadly sins is your social product subscribing to?" -- Reid Hoffman

"Humour is the delivery mechanism for truth." -- Biz Stone

"Sometimes the founder isn't the best person to be the CEO.. kinda like a rock band!" -- Kim Polese

"There's nothing that is massively successful that doesn't have some luck. But you have to plan for both good and bad luck." -- Reid Hoffman

"Entrepreneurism means becoming mortal.. being able to give it 100% and be able to fail." -- Biz Stone

"The future is always sooner and stranger than you think." -- Reid Hoffman

"You don't motivate people by being a cheerleader." -- Kim Polese

"The failure of imagination does not constitute an insight into necessity." -- Reid Hoffman

Halo Legends

Directed by: Frank O'Connor, Joseph Chou

Produced by: Bonnie Ross, John Ledford

Distributed by: Warner Bros. Pictures

Release date: February 16, 2010




Halo Legends is an animation anthology series bearing a striking resemblance to other similar series such as "Animatrix", "Batman: Gotham Knight", etc. It consists of 7 short animated stories that explore areas of the rich Halo game universe. These 7 stories span the entire history of the Halo Universe. Of all the seven stories my favorites are ‘The Prototype’ and ‘The Babysitter’.

I’ve always been a fan of Halo – the game. So when I heard that a movie on the legend of Halo is coming up, I was excited.

Here’s a quick description (from the DVD) of what Halo Legends is all about: “This sweeping science-fiction saga delves into the rich Halo universe with seven exciting stories (told in eight parts) focused on Master Chief’s mysterious origins, the Spartans’ advanced combat capabilities and the tense rivalry between Spartans and Orbital Drop Shock Troopers (ODSTs). Created in collaboration with some of the world’s leading animators from Japan, Halo Legends draws you into the center of humankind’s ongoing battles with the Covenant, dynamically depicted in cutting-edge animation styles that delivers breathtaking visuals and gripping adventure. Go beyond the game – and join the roll call of Halo Legends.”

Animation/Design

My rating: 9 on 10

Rich 3D/2D graphics. Highly detailed scenery and the characters. Loved the overall look and feel.

Story

My Rating: 7.5 on 10

Although the plot has 7 stories and don’t go by the rating. They are all good stories in their own right. But, the only thing that I missed was lack of a common character or a strong thread to hold the stories together.

Overall Rating

8 on 10

Overall, if you’re a fan of animation (which I am J) you’ll probably like HALO LEGENDS. If you're a Halo nut, you'll most likely love it.
